Output 6030526dd8de792433919e3883e3e6f36c74d8021a91dae36d58465338557631:9

value
20000
script pubkey
OP_0 OP_PUSHBYTES_20 20819eb3d7d227bc81c14ff062111373217db60d
address
bc1qyzqeav7h6gnmeqwpflcxyygnwvshmdsdfjslhd
transaction
6030526dd8de792433919e3883e3e6f36c74d8021a91dae36d58465338557631
confirmations
159800
spent
true